Belle Vue racer Connor Bailey has been crowned British Under-21 champion after making a triumphant return to former Cab Direct Championship home track Glasgow on Sunday.

Bailey, who also rides for Championship club Redcar and National League side Workington, won the Grand Final ahead of SGP2 series reserve Anders Rowe, Dan Thompson and Dan Gilkes.

King’s Lynn and Poole rider Rowe topped the heat score chart over the qualifying heats with a 15-point maximum, but he was denied by Bailey when it mattered most.

Bailey bagged 13 points over his five heats to join Rowe in qualifying automatically for the Grand Final.

Gilkes triumphed in the last-chance race ahead of Thompson, with Drew Kemp placed third and Jason Edwards fourth.

Edwards piled up 12 points over five rides to finish third on the heat scorechart, before suffering heartbreak in the last-chance race. Gilkes and Thompson both registered 11 apiece in the qualifiers, with Kemp making the semi on 10, pipping Wolverhampton and Berwick favourite Leon Flint in countback. Sam Hagon fell just short of the semis on nine.

BRITISH UNDER-21 CHAMPIONSHIP FINAL HEAT SCORES: Anders Rowe 15, Connor Bailey 13, Jason Edwards 12, Dan Gilkes 11, Dan Thompson 11, Drew Kemp 10, Leon Flint 10, Sam Hagon 9, Nathan Ablitt 8, Ashton Boughen 6, Sam McGurk 5, Ace Pijper 3, Ben Trigger 3, Jody Scott 2, Mickie Simpson 2, Freddy Hodder 0.

SEMI-FINAL: Gilkes, Thompson, Kemp, Edwards.

FINAL: Bailey, Rowe, Thompson, Gilkes.
